Rosalie Summers is a productivity junkie. Currently enrolled at King's University, she lives with her socialite brother on campus, and as of recently, his best friend. Tristan Hollows is a young, wealthy bachelor. With no family to spend occasions with, Tristan is invited to all of her family events. You'll never see him shed a tear, bare a smile, or talk about his feelings. No, Tristan is as cold as it gets. So, what the hell makes him so appealing? Rosalie has no clue; all she knows is that she can't enter another relationship that puts her in handcuffs. Metaphorical handcuffs, of course. Rosalie has seen and experienced toxic relationships all her life. Although that particularly dark time in her life is now long gone, she is terrified to fall into it again. As she learns that her desire might be reciprocated with Tristan, Rosalie will do anything and everything to steer clear of him. He's the only person who can make her drop down to her knees, and that scares her. Tristan is powerful in every way imaginable. He's controlling and isn't accustomed to hearing 'no' from anyone. Well, Tristan, meet your match.
